The Chevrolet Malibu (2008-2012) is a mid-size sedan recognized for its blend of style, comfort, and reliability. The electrical system of the Malibu is crucial for the functionality of various features, from essential engine components to comfort and convenience features, with fuse boxes and relays playing significant roles in ensuring safe and efficient operation.

The fuse box in the Chevrolet Malibu is found in two primary locations: the engine compartment and inside the cabin, usually on the passenger side. The engine compartment fuse box protects high-current circuits, including those for the engine, cooling fans, and anti-lock braking system (ABS). Meanwhile, the interior fuse box manages circuits for accessories such as the power windows, radio, and interior lights. Fuses in these boxes protect each circuit by breaking the connection if there’s an electrical overload or short circuit, preventing damage to other components.

Relays in the Malibu are used to control high-power circuits for components like the starter motor, fuel pump, and HVAC system. These relays enable the safe operation of these high-current circuits by using low-current signals to control them, ensuring both efficiency and safety. Regular maintenance of fuses and relays is essential to prevent electrical issues and ensure the vehicle’s reliable operation.

WARNING

  • Never replace a fuse with one that has a higher amperage rating.
  • A fuse with a too-high amperage could damage the electrical part and cause a fire.
  • On no account should fuses be repaired (e.g. patched up with tin foil or wire) as this may cause serious damage elsewhere in the electrical circuit or cause a fire.
  • If a fuse blows repeatedly, do not keep replacing it. Instead, have the cause for the repeated short circuit or overload tracked and fixed.

Passenger Compartment Fuse Box

Fuse box location

It is located on the passenger side of the vehicle, on the lower portion of the instrument panel near the floor, behind the cover.

Assignment of the fuses and relays in the Passenger Compartment

Name Usage
POWER MIRRORS Power Mirrors
EPS Electric Power Steering
RUN/CRANK Cruise Control Switch, Passenger Airbag Status Indicator
HVAC BLOWER HIGH Heating Ventilation Air Conditioning Blower – High Speed Relay
CLUSTER/THEFT Instrument Panel Cluster, Theft Deterrent System
ONSTAR OnStar (If Equipped)
NOT INSTALLED Not Used
AIRBAG (IGN) Airbag (Ignition)
HVAC CTRL (BATT) Heating Ventilation Air Conditioning Control Diagnostic Link Connector (Battery)
PEDAL Not Used
WIPER SW Windshield Wiper/ Washer Switch
IGN SENSOR Ignition Switch
STRG WHL ILLUM Steering Wheel Illumination
NOT INSTALLED Not Used
RADIO Audio System
INTERIOR LIGHTS Interior Lamps
NOT INSTALLED Not Used
POWER WINDOWS Power Windows
HVAC CTRL (IGN) Heating Ventilation Air Conditioning Control (Ignition)
HVAC BLOWER Heating Ventilation Air Conditioning Blower Switch
DOOR LOCK Door Locks
ROOF/HEAT SEAT Sunroof, Heated Seat
NOT INSTALLED Not Used
NOT INSTALLED Not Used
AIRBAG (BATT) Airbag (Battery)
SPARE FUSE HOLDER Spare Fuse Holder
SPARE FUSE HOLDER Spare Fuse Holder
SPARE FUSE HOLDER Spare Fuse Holder
SPARE FUSE HOLDER Spare Fuse Holder
FUSE PULLER Fuse Puller

Assignment of the fuses and relay in the Engine Compartment

Name Usage
1 Air Conditioning Clutch
2 Electronic Throttle Control
3 2008-2009: Engine Control Module IGN 1(LZ4 & LZE)
2010-2012: Not Used
4 Transmission Control Module Ignition 1
5 Mass Airflow Sensor (LY7)
6 Emission
7 Left Headlamp Low-Beam
8 Horn
9 Right Headlamp Low-Beam
10 Front Fog Lamps
11 Left Headlamp High-Beam
12 Right Headlamp High-Beam
13 Engine Control Module BATT
14 Windshield Wiper
15 Antilock Brake System (IGN 1)
16 Engine Control Module IGN 1
17 Cooling Fan 1
18 Cooling Fan 2
19 Run Relay, Heating, Ventilation, Air Conditioning Blower
20 Body Control Module 1
21 Body Control Module Run/Crank
22 Rear Electrical Center 1
23 Rear Electrical Center 2
24 Anti-lock Brake System
25 Body Control Module 2
26 Starter
41 Electric Power Steering
42 Transmission Control Module Battery
43 Ignition Module (LZ4, LZE, LE9 & LE5); Injectors, Ignition Coils Odd (LY7)
44 Injectors (LZ4, LZE, LE9 & LE5); Injectors, Ignition Coils Even (LY7)
45 Post Cat 02 Sensor Heaters (LY7)
46 Daytime Running Lamps
47 Center High-Mounted Stoplamp
50 Driver Power Window
51 2008-2009: Engine Control Module BATT(LZ4 & LZE)
2010-2012: Not Used
52 AIR Solenoid
54 Regulated Voltage Control
55 DC/AC Inverter
56 Antilock Brake System BATT
Relays
28 Cooling Fan 1
29 Cooling Fan Mode Series/Parallel
30 Cooling Fan 2
31 Starter
32 Run/Crank, Ignition
33 Powertrain
34 Air Conditioning Clutch
35 High Beam
36 Front Fog Lamps
37 Horn
38 Low-Beam Headlamps
39 Windshield Wiper 1
40 Windshield Wiper 2
48 Daytime Running Lamps
49 Stoplamps
53 AIR Solenoid
Diode
27 Wiper

Luggage Compartment Fuse Box

Fuse box location

Rear Compartment Fuse Block is located in the luggage compartment (on the left-side), behind the cover.

Assignment of the fuses and relay in the Luggage Compartment

Name Usage
1 Passenger Seat Controls
2 Driver Seat Controls
3 Not Used
4 Not Used
5 Emission 2, Canister Vent Solenoid
6 Park Lamps, Instrument Panel Dimming
7 Not Used
8 Not Used
9 Not Used
10 Sunroof Controls
11 Not Used
12 Not Used
13 Audio Amplifier
14 Heated Seat Controls
15 Not Used
16 Remote Keyless Entry (RKE) System, XM Satellite Radio (If Equipped)
17 Back-up Lamps
18 Not Used
19 Not Used
20 Auxiliary Power Outlets
21 Not Used
22 Trunk Release
23 Rear Defog
24 Heated Mirror
25 Fuel Pump
Relays
26 Rear Window Defogger
27 Park Lamps
28 Not Used
29 Not Used
30 Not Used
31 Not Used
32 Not Used
33 Back-up Lamps
34 Not Used
35 Not Used
36 Trunk Release
37 Fuel Pump
38 (Diode) Cargo Lamp
